Mind Influence
Mind influence is the effect type that affects thought, perception, or memory. The operation doesn't change the target's body or fortune; it changes what they think, what they see, or what they remember.
Its strength is invisibility. Done well, the target doesn't know the operation has been performed; their thoughts simply seem to be their own thoughts. Its weakness is fragility — strong-willed targets can resist mind influence outright, and mind influence operations can be detected and reversed by other sorcerers.

How mind-influence sorcerers grow
Their career runs through learning to operate invisibly.
Beginner mind-influence sorcerers learn simple persuasion and basic perception illusions.
Mid-rank brings working memory operations and stronger perception illusions.
High rank brings out signature operations against strong-willed targets.
Top-rank mind-influence sorcerers can sustain operations on multiple targets simultaneously.
